Discover the vibrant Italian dining scene in Seattle's Greenwood neighborhood, where the fusion of authentic flavors and culinary traditions creates a unique gastronomic journey. This area is renowned for its array of Italian eateries that cater to a diverse range of tastes and preferences, each offering a distinctive twist on classic Italian cuisine. From cozy, family-run bistros to elegant dining experiences, Greenwood provides an excellent backdrop for exploring the rich, flavorful world of Italian food. The restaurants in this locale pride themselves on using fresh, high-quality ingredients to craft dishes that are both traditional and innovative. Menus are abundant with options ranging from handcrafted pasta and wood-fired pizzas to gourmet antipasti and decadent desserts, ensuring that there's something to satisfy every palate. The dining atmosphere in Greenwood is equally appealing, characterized by warm, inviting spaces that blend rustic Italian charm with contemporary sophistication. Whether you're a local foodie or a visitor looking to indulge in Seattle's culinary delights, the Italian restaurants in Greenwood offer an exceptional dining experience that highlights the best of Italy’s culinary heritage. This neighborhood is not just a place to eat; it's a destination where food lovers can gather to celebrate life and enjoy the pleasures of a well-prepared meal.
